Summary Information Automatically generated summary
See sections below for more information The gene
Cdc37 is referred to in FlyBase by the symbol
Dmel\Cdc37 (CG12019, FBgn0011573). It is a protein_coding_gene from
Drosophila melanogaster . Based on sequence similarity, it is predicted to have
molecular function : unfolded protein binding. There is experimental evidence that it is involved in the
biological process : neurogenesis.
20 alleles are reported . The
phenotypes of these alleles are annotated with: actomyosin contractile ring; rhabdomere; adult abdomen; spermatid; spindle; nucleus. It has
one annotated transcript and
one annotated polypeptide .
Protein features are: Cdc37; Cdc37, C-terminal; Cdc37, Hsp90 binding; Cdc37, N-terminal domain. Summary of modENCODE Temporal Expression Profile: Temporal profile ranges from a peak of high expression to a trough of moderately high expression. Peak expression observed within 00-12 hour embryonic stages, during late larval stages, at stages throughout the pupal period, in stages of adults of both sexes. Summary of FlyAtlas Anatomical Expression Data: High or moderate levels of expression observed in all larval and adult organs/tissues. Expression at high levels in the following post-embryonic organs or tissues: adult testis. Expression at moderate levels in the following post-embryonic organs or tissues: adult head, adult eye, larval/adult central nervous system, adult crop, larval/adult midgut, larval/adult hindgut, larval/adult Malpighian tubules, adult heart, larval/adult fat body, larval/adult salivary gland, larval trachea, adult female reproductive system, adult male accessory gland, larval/adult carcass. Cdc37 protein is ubiquitously distributed in the cytoplasm of cellularized embryos. It is also ubiquitously expressed in late embryos and third instar eye imaginal disc.

Other Information Discoverer Etymology Identification Relationship to Other Genes Source for database identity of Source for database merge of Additional comments Other Comments The activity of
cdc2 is highly sensitive to
Cdc37 levels, suggesting that the two genes may act in a common pathway to regulate cell cycle control.
Mutants of
Cdc37 display strong suppression of
tor mutant embryos, embryos display 4 to 6 abdominal denticle belts.
Cdc37 is required for cell growth and viability.
